  1. OOps sorry!!!!!!!LOL.Its for senative skin By "ego" There a is a whole line of QV product you can get it at your local chemist. It about $12 a 500ml bottle i think.U only need 2 caps worth in a laundry tubs worth.You can also get a non-soap cleansing bar but i have found it leaves thier coat dry.The olive oil soap (brand it Priya and you get it from woolworths)Puts oil through their coat. but doesn't leave them greasy.
  2. Sound unusual but works a treat. My fella fits in laundry tub so i 3/4 fill it and put 2 cap fulls in goes milky

Yep capstar......Also wash My Joe on pure olive oil soap then soak him in QV bath oil for 5 or so minutes.It really takes the redness out of the itchyness.Stay way from shampoos and heavly scented products.Vet has also given me some anti-hystamine "FRAMINE "for his really itchy days.No long term effects. Lillypilly, I wouldn't worry too much bout him not eating just yet....Eddie hadn't eaten for 10days, but he was on a drip all along and he lost less than a kilo in that time...Specialist told me that in the depression vets experimented with dogs to see how long they could go without food before damage to organs was done.....Aparently it was about a month.My research ,when Ed got ill was that even smelling food causes the pancreas to release juices and cause more inflamation.As long as he's on a drip for fluids he can go a bit long with no tucker...I know it's hard though all you want is for them to eat...Even with my new dog Joey i stress a little if he doesn't eat his dinnner. Same thing happened to my boy Eddie in Feb this year...He too was only 4yrs old.Got real sick all of a sudden one night.Blood test didnt show up as pancreatitis but when he started to go jaundice a few day later an ultra-sound showed a swollen pancreaes...When his jaundice wasn't going away a 2nd ultra sound showed it had gone down but the bile duct coming out of the gallbladder had become inflamed and blocked....He was to have surgery the nxt morning but he had a heart attack before they were to start...It's suspected that his gallbladder had ruptured. 10 days before he started on Phenabarbital for seizures(epilepsy) that had become more frequent.The specialist thinks that this may have a contributing factor as the medication makes FAT store in the blood...He did say it's very rare for this complication to occur ( a 1 in 10,000). I was told how ever if he did recover from this that he would have to be on a LOW FAT DIET as he would be extremely prone to re-occurence of it.
